Actor Kim Jae Wook left viewers with a powerful afterglow, sending second‑lead syndrome into overdrive with no way out.

In tvN’s weekend drama Secret Audit, which aired its finale on the 31st, Kim Jae Wook played Jeon Jae‑yeol, the executive vice chairman overseeing Haemu Group, portraying the character’s layered inner world with calm precision and depth. Though Jeon appears flawless on the surface, he carries old wounds and a profound emptiness—an arc Kim completed with steady, compelling acting that drew widespread praise.

Within the story, Jeon Jae‑yeol stands at the heart of Haemu Group, bearing the weight of his title as vice chairman, family‑entangled scars, and crushing responsibility. Kim seamlessly connected the character’s dramatic shifts—from the early episodes’ composed, meticulous aura of a born owner, to a mid‑series spiral under the burden of duty, and finally to the closing chapter where he lays everything down and finds true freedom.

Rather than forcing sudden surges of anxiety, exhaustion, and fractured emotion, he built them convincingly through subtle tremors in expression, nuanced eye contact, and delicate shifts in vocal tone. Watching him break free from the yoke that had smothered him and reclaim his life delivered a heavy catharsis for viewers.

Even amid the razor‑tight power struggle inside Haemu Group surrounding the audit office, the character never lost his edge thanks to Kim Jae Wook’s uniquely commanding aura. In sharp confrontations and strategic alliances with the audit team’s leads—including Joo In‑a (played by Shin Hye Sun)—he adjusted the warmth of his gaze depending on his counterpart, crafting wide‑ranging chemistry with remarkable control.
